编程pa是什么

编程pa是什么

编程pa是一种基于互联网的编程平台或工具,旨在提供给开发者高效、便利的编程环境和资源。它允许用户在云端创建、修改、测试和部署代码,从而提高开发效率和项目管理的灵活性。1、提高开发效率2、便利化的项目管理是其两大核心优势。尤其是在提高开发效率方面,编程pa通过预配置的开发环境、集成开发工具(IDE)和自动化的部署流程,极大地简化了开发者的工作流程,让他们可以专注于代码编写而非环境配置,从而加速项目的开发进度。

一、提高开发效率

编程pa通过提供一个预配置和高度定制的开发环境,显著减少了开发者在环境搭建上的时间消耗。常见的编程pa平台能够支持多种编程语言和框架,满足不同项目的需求。这意味着开发者无需在本地机器上配置复杂的开发环境,而是可以直接在云端开始编写、测试代码。更重要的是,一些平台还提供了代码协作功能,使得团队成员能够实时共享代码修改,有效提升团队的协作效率。

二、便利化的项目管理

除了开发效率的提升,编程pa还为项目管理带来了便利。通过集成的项目管理工具,开发者可以有效地跟踪和协调项目进度,实现更加高效的任务分配和进度监控。例如,一些编程pa平台内置的看板和任务列表可以帮助团队成员清晰地了解自己的任务安排和优先级,而集成的版本控制系统则确保了代码的版本管理和协作开发更加顺畅。

三、加速项目部署和测试

编程pa平台通常提供了自动化的代码部署工具,使得代码从开发到上线的过程变得更加迅速和便捷。开发者只需通过简单的配置就可以实现代码的自动编译、打包和部署,极大地缩短了项目的交付周期。此外,许多编程pa还支持沙盒环境的测试,允许开发者在一个与生产环境隔离的环境中测试代码,确保代码的稳定性和可靠性。

四、提供丰富的开发资源和社区支持

编程pa不仅提供了基础的编程环境和工具,很多平台还聚集了丰富的开发资源和社区支持。开发者可以在这些平台上访问到各种库、框架、API等资源,极大地丰富了开发的可能性。同时,活跃的社区也为开发者提供了一个交流经验、解决问题的平台,有利于提升开发技能和扩展知识面。

总的来说,编程pa作为一种现代化的编程环境和工具,通过提供高效的开发环境、便捷的项目管理、加速的项目部署和丰富的开发资源,极大地提升了软件开发的效率和质量。对于现今追求速度和效率的开发团队来说,充分利用编程pa的优势,无疑将对项目成功有着重要的促进作用。

相关问答FAQs:

编程PA是什么?

编程PA(Program Analysis)是一种软件工程领域的技术,旨在通过对程序代码进行静态或动态分析,以帮助开发人员提高代码质量、效率和安全性。编程PA可以帮助开发人员理解代码的结构和行为,检测潜在的缺陷和错误,并提供指导和建议以改进代码。

编程PA有哪些应用场景?

编程PA在软件开发和维护过程中有广泛的应用。以下是一些常见的应用场景:

  1. 代码质量分析:编程PA可以帮助开发人员检测代码中的潜在缺陷,如空指针引用、内存泄漏、逻辑错误等。通过提供静态分析和动态分析的结果,开发人员可以及时修复这些问题,提高代码的可靠性和可维护性。

  2. 性能优化:编程PA可以分析代码执行的性能瓶颈,并给出优化建议。例如,它可以识别不必要的循环、低效的算法或资源浪费的代码段,并提供替代方案以改进代码的性能。

  3. 安全漏洞检测:编程PA可以识别代码中的潜在安全漏洞,并提供相应的修复建议。例如,它可以检测到采用不安全的加密算法、没有输入验证的代码等,并帮助开发人员采取必要的措施来保护代码免受潜在的攻击。

  4. 代码重构支持:编程PA可以分析代码的结构和依赖关系,并给出重构建议。通过识别出代码中的冗余、复杂或紧耦合的部分,开发人员可以进行代码重构,以提高代码的可读性和可维护性。

编程PA的工具有哪些?

目前,有许多编程PA工具可供开发人员使用。以下是一些常见的编程PA工具:

  1. 静态分析工具:这类工具通过对代码的静态分析,发现其中的问题。常见的静态分析工具有PMD、FindBugs、Checkstyle等。它们可以识别出代码中的潜在编程错误、不规范的代码风格和低效的算法。

  2. 动态分析工具:这类工具通过在代码执行过程中收集数据,并进行相应的分析,发现其中的问题。常见的动态分析工具有Debug工具、性能分析工具等。它们可以帮助开发人员追踪代码的执行轨迹、查找内存泄漏等问题,并辅助性能优化。

  3. 代码检查工具:这类工具通过对代码进行检查,发现其中的问题。常见的代码检查工具有Lint、ESLint等。它们可以识别出代码中的语法错误、逻辑错误和潜在的安全问题。

总的来说,编程PA是一种有助于提高代码质量和开发效率的技术,它可以帮助开发人员发现和修复代码中的问题,并提供指导和建议来改进代码。通过使用各种编程PA工具,开发人员可以更加高效地进行软件开发和维护。

文章标题:编程pa是什么,发布者:不及物动词,转载请注明出处:https://worktile.com/kb/p/1787656

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
不及物动词不及物动词
上一篇 2024年5月2日
下一篇 2024年5月2日

相关推荐

  • 学编程PLC要买什么电脑

    学习PLC编程不必购置高性能电脑,主要关注三个方面: 1、处理器性能、2、稳定的内存容量、以及3、足够的硬盘存储。在处理器性能方面,多数PLC编程软件对CPU的要求不高,但考虑未来学习的可能性扩展和软件的更新,选择具有较好性能的处理器能保证软件运行的流畅度和未来的兼容性,例如,中高端的i5或i7处理…

    2024年5月16日
    3600
  • 用什么编程公式炒股好

    实现股市自动化交易的成功率较高的几种编程公式分别是移动平均线交叉、相对强弱指数(RSI)、MACD交叉和量价分析。在这些方法中,移动平均线交叉是一种常用的技术分析工具,它基于两条不同周期的移动平均线之间的关系来决定买卖时机。当短期平均线从下方穿越长期平均线时,通常被解释为买入信号,反之则为卖出信号。…

    2024年5月16日
    1900
  • 新手编程序用什么软件

    新手编程推荐使用的软件有1、Visual Studio Code、 2、Sublime Text、 3、Atom。 对于初学者来说,Visual Studio Code(VS Code)是一个十分理想的选择。它是由微软开发的一款免费、开源的编辑器,支持多种编程语言,并且具有强大的社区支持。VS Co…

    2024年5月16日
    2700
  • 编码编程是什么意思

    编码编程是1、使用编程语言将指令转换成机器可以执行的代码、2、软件开发过程中的一个重要环节。在这个过程中,最显著的特点是将解决问题的策略和逻辑用具体的编程语言形式表达出来。这就需要开发者不仅要掌握一门或多门编程语言,还需要具备逻辑思维和解决问题的能力。通过编码,开发者能够让计算机执行特定任务,从而达…

    2024年5月16日
    600
  • 网上教编程的是什么

    网上教授编程主要是通过数字平台向用户提供编程知识与技能的学习资源和指导。在这种方式中,互动式教学特别受到重视,因为它能够模拟真实的编程环境,让学习者在实践中掌握知识。这种教学方法不仅包括视频课程、在线讲座和实时代码编写实践,还可能涵盖编程挑战和项目构建等元素,用以增强学习者的实战能力。 I、互动平台…

    2024年5月16日
    800

发表回复

登录后才能评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部